首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

术语聚合不返回其他存储桶

是指在云计算领域中,当进行术语聚合操作时,不返回其他存储桶的数据。

概念:术语聚合是指将多个术语或关键词聚合在一起,形成一个更具代表性和全面性的术语列表或词汇集合。通过术语聚合,可以更好地组织和管理大量的术语和关键词。

分类:术语聚合可以根据聚合的对象进行分类,例如可以按照不同的主题、领域、行业进行分类。

优势:术语聚合不返回其他存储桶的优势主要有两点:首先,可以避免返回不相关的数据,提高检索的准确性和效率;其次,可以保护其他存储桶中的数据隐私和安全。

应用场景:术语聚合不返回其他存储桶的应用场景非常广泛。例如在搜索引擎中,当用户输入查询关键词时,系统可以通过术语聚合来展示相关的术语或关键词,从而帮助用户更好地理解和扩展查询。另外,在文档管理系统中,术语聚合也可以用来提供更准确的分类和标签,帮助用户更好地组织和查找文档。

推荐的腾讯云相关产品:腾讯云提供了一系列与云存储相关的产品,其中腾讯云对象存储 COS(Cloud Object Storage)是一种安全、持久、可扩展的云端对象存储服务。通过 COS,用户可以方便地存储和检索任意类型的数据,支持多种数据管理和访问方式。了解更多关于腾讯云 COS 的信息,请访问:腾讯云 COS 产品介绍

总结:术语聚合不返回其他存储桶是指在云计算领域中,通过将多个术语或关键词聚合在一起,形成一个更具代表性和全面性的术语列表或词汇集合,但在这个过程中不返回其他存储桶的数据。这种方法可以提高检索的准确性和效率,并保护其他存储桶中的数据隐私和安全。腾讯云对象存储 COS 是一款推荐的云存储产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Elasticsearch:透彻理解 Elasticsearch 中的 Bucket aggregation

除了存储本身之外,存储聚合还计算并返回落入每个存储的文档数量。 与指标聚合相反,存储聚合可以保存子聚合。 这些子聚合将针对其“父”存储聚合创建的存储进行聚合。...在本文中,我们将重点介绍直方图(histogram),范围(range),过滤器(filter)和术语(terms)等存储聚合。 让我们开始吧! 什么是?...术语聚合会在文档的指定字段中搜索唯一值,并为找到的每个唯一值构建存储。 与过滤器聚合不同,术语聚合的任务不是将结果限制为特定值,而是查找文档中给定字段的所有唯一值。...(如果min_doc_count大于0,则不会返回存储)。...IP聚合的工作方式与其他范围聚合类似。

2.7K40

Elasticsearch使用:Bucket aggregation

除了存储本身之外,存储聚合还计算并返回落入每个存储的文档数量。 与指标聚合相反,存储聚合可以保存子聚合。 这些子聚合将针对其“父”存储聚合创建的存储进行聚合。...在本文中,我们将重点介绍直方图(histogram),范围(range),过滤器(filter)和术语(terms)等存储聚合。...术语聚合会在文档的指定字段中搜索唯一值,并为找到的每个唯一值构建存储。 与过滤器聚合不同,术语聚合的任务不是将结果限制为特定值,而是查找文档中给定字段的所有唯一值。...(如果min_doc_count大于0,则不会返回存储)。...IP聚合的工作方式与其他范围聚合类似。

3.2K11
  • Es Bucket聚合(聚合) Terms Aggregation与Significant Terms Aggregation

    Terms Aggregation 多值聚合,根据库中的文档动态构建。...Terms 聚合支持如下常用参数: size 可以通过size返回top size的文档,该术语聚合针对顶层术语包含嵌套词根),其搜索过程是将请求向所有分片节点发送请求,每个分片节点返回size条数据...要发现所有其他警察部队的异常情况,我们必须对每个不同的警察部队重复查询。 如何解决该问题呢?请看下文。...Significant聚合的分数如何计算 如果术语在子集中(foreground set)出现的频率和在背景中(background sets)出现的频率有显著差异,则认为该术语是重要的。...在这种情况下,最好执行两个搜索——第一个搜索提供一个合理的重要术语列表,然后将这个术语短列表添加到第二个查询中,以返回并获取所需的子聚合

    7.4K10

    开始使用Elasticsearch (3)

    为了更好地理解这些类型,通常更容易将它们分为四个主要方面: Bucketing 构建存储的一系列聚合,其中每个存储与密钥和文档标准相关联。...执行聚合时,将在上下文中的每个文档上评估所有存储条件,并且当条件匹配时,文档被视为“落入”相关存储。在聚合过程结束时,我们最终会得到一个列表 - 每个都有一组“属于”它的文档。...与度量标准和存储聚合不同,此聚合系列尚不支持脚本。 Pipeline 聚合其他聚合的输出及其关联度量的聚合 接下来是有趣的部分。...由于每个存储( bucket )有效地定义了一个文档集(属于该 bucket 的所有文档),因此可以在 bucket 级别上关联聚合,并且这些聚合将在该存储的上下文中执行。...我们也可以直接使用 script 的方法来进行聚合。在这种情况下,我们可以指定特定的 field 。

    1.6K30

    Elasticsearch:pipeline aggregation 介绍

    管道聚合有很多不同类型,每种类型都与其他聚合计算不同的信息,但是可以将这些类型分为两类: Parent      基于父级聚合的输出提供一组管道聚合,它可以计算新的存储或新的聚合以添加到现有存储中...你还记得,指标和存储聚合使用 “missing” 参数来处理数据中的缺口。管道聚合使用 gap_policy 参数来处理文档包含必填字段或没有文档匹配一个或多个存储查询的情况等。...仔细研究我们上面描述的步骤,您可以了解管道聚合的工作方式。 他们采用指标和/或存储聚合的中间结果,并对其进行其他计算。...当您的数据包含中间结果时,此方法非常有用,并且中间结果应在聚合过程中隐式导出。 Derivative Aggregation 这里写 Derivative 就是我们数学术语里的导数。...这样,它将累加序列中所有存储的总和。 总结: 而已! 如我们所见,管道聚合有助于实现涉及中间值和其他聚合产生的存储的复杂计算。

    2.2K42

    Elasticsearch探索:使用pipeline aggregation

    管道聚合有很多不同类型,每种类型都与其他聚合计算不同的信息,但是可以将这些类型分为两类: Parent      基于父级聚合的输出提供一组管道聚合,它可以计算新的存储或新的聚合以添加到现有存储中...你还记得,指标和存储聚合使用 “missing” 参数来处理数据中的缺口。管道聚合使用 gap_policy 参数来处理文档包含必填字段或没有文档匹配一个或多个存储查询的情况等。...仔细研究我们上面描述的步骤,您可以了解管道聚合的工作方式。 他们采用指标和/或存储聚合的中间结果,并对其进行其他计算。...当您的数据包含中间结果时,此方法非常有用,并且中间结果应在聚合过程中隐式导出。 Derivative Aggregation 这里写 Derivative 就是我们数学术语里的导数。...这样,它将累加序列中所有存储的总和。 总结 管道聚合有助于实现涉及中间值和其他聚合产生的存储的复杂计算。

    1.1K31

    OpenTSDB翻译-降采样

    降采样器至少需要两个组件: 时间间隔(interval)- 一个时间范围(或存储),用于聚合这些值。例如:我们可以将1分钟或1小时甚至整整一天的多个值聚合。...每个间隔或存储将包含包含存储时间戳(start)的数据点,并且不包括以下存储的时间戳(end),即[start, end)半开半闭区间。...从那里开始计算间隔直到查询的结束时间。每个存储都标有存储开始的时间戳(包含,闭区间),并包括所有的值,直到下一个存储开始为止。...只要降采样为空,填充策略就会简单地发出预定义的值。   可用的策略包括: None(none) –默认行为,在序列化过程中不会发出缺失值,并在聚合序列时执行线性插值(或其他指定的插值)。...零值将被合并到聚合结果中。   要使用填充策略,请将策略名称(括号中的术语)附加到由连字符分隔的降采样聚合函数的末尾。例如1h-sum-nan或1m-avg-zero。

    1.7K20

    Elasticsearch使用:Rare Terms Aggregation(7.3版新功能)

    搜索的时候,我们想得到的是每个里满足条件的文档最多的搜索结果。...但是有些情况,我们想寻找稀有的术语数量。尽管我们可以把我们的搜索结果按照升序来排序,但是对于很大数据的这种聚合操作很容易造成 unbunded error。...它是一种聚合,用于识别长系列关键词的尾部的数据,例如文档数较少的字词。从技术角度来看,稀有术语汇总通过维护术语映射以及与每个值关联的计数器来进行。每次识别该术语时,计数器都会增加。...细心的开发者可以参考Elastic的 Terms aggeration 官方文档,可以看到这样的一段文字: image.png 它的意思是使用升序来进行排序是建议的一种方法。...这意味着将返回符合max_doc_count 条件的字词。 Rare terms aggregation 以这种方式起作用,以避免困扰术语聚合的升序问题。

    99741

    Elasticsearch 与 OpenSearch:扩大性能差距

    日期直方图聚合可用于通过将基于时间的数据划分为间隔或存储聚合和分析数据。此功能使用户能够可视化并更好地了解一段时间内的趋势、模式和异常情况。...1.5 术语 "根据一起购买的产品对数据进行分组。" image7 Elasticsearch 展示了其优越性,与 OpenSearch 相比,术语查询速度快 108%,复合术语聚合速度快 103%。...Elasticsearch 中的"重要术语"聚合会自动排除常见或不感兴趣的术语,例如停用词("and"、"the"、"a")或结果中索引中频繁出现的术语。...2.3 数据集和摄取 [使用该开源工具][4]生成了 1TB 数据集,然后将其上传到 GCP 存储。...Logstash (®)用于将 GCP 存储中的数据集提取到 Elasticsearch 和 OpenSearch 中。存储库中还包含生成类似数据集的说明,以防您想要复制基准测试。

    26810

    【腾讯云ES】Elasticsearch Aggregations数据统计实践

    聚合可以分级使用,每个中的文档可以再次进行聚合(sub-aggregations)。...可作为分聚合的子级聚合(sub-aggregations),部分分聚合支持使用各中的统计指标对进行排序。...Pipeline Aggregations 管道聚合根据其他聚合结果,而不是索引中的文档数据进行计算,计算结果会添加到结果树中。...extended_bounds用来指定返回数据的范围,如果指定,只返回有数据的,可以和min_doc_count配合使用。...aggs中的size用于指定返回的最大桶数,默认返回包含文档数最多的10个。最大不超过search.max_buckets设置。如果超过1000,可以考虑增加aggs.size的值。

    1.4K30

    一起学Elasticsearch系列-聚合查询

    Pipeline Aggregations(管道聚合):这些聚合操作通过在其他聚合结果上执行额外的计算来产生新的聚合结果。例如,使用 Moving Average 聚合可以计算出移动平均值。...Doc Values(文档值):Doc Values 是一种以列式存储格式保存字段值的数据结构,它用于支持快速的聚合、排序和统计操作。...管道聚合 在 Elasticsearch 中,管道聚合(pipeline aggregations)是指这样一种聚合:它以其他聚合的结果作为输入,并进行进一步处理。..."size": 10 的意思是只返回销售量最高的前10个产品(即只返回前10个)。 "order": { "_count": "desc" } 表示按中文档的数量(也就是销售量)降序排序。...返回的结果将包含按照 product_id 升序排列的产品 ID 列表,每个产品 ID 对应一个,并且每个内包含对应产品的销售记录。

    59320

    Elasticsearch: Rare Terms Aggregation

    集成X-Pack高级特性,适用日志分析/企业搜索/BI分析等场景 ---- 在许多的情况下,我们做 terms聚合 搜索的时候,我们想得到的是每个里满足条件的文档最多的搜索结果。...但是有些情况,我们想寻找稀有的术语数量。尽管我们可以把我们的搜索结果按照升序来排序,但是对于很大数据的这种聚合操作很容易造成 unbunded error。...它是一种聚合,用于识别长系列关键词的尾部的数据,例如文档数较少的字词。从技术角度来看,稀有术语汇总通过维护术语映射以及与每个值关联的计数器来进行。每次识别该术语时,计数器都会增加。...细心的开发者可以参考Elastic的 Terms aggeration 官方文档,可以看到这样的一段文字: 5.png 它的意思是使用升序来进行排序是建议的一种方法。...这意味着将返回符合max_doc_count 条件的字词。 Rare terms aggregation 以这种方式起作用,以避免困扰术语聚合的升序问题。

    90063

    学好Elasticsearch系列-聚合查询

    Pipeline Aggregations:这类聚合可以基于其他聚合的结果进行二次计算。比如计算差异、比例、移动平均等。...用于进行聚合的字段必须是exact value,分词字段不可进行聚合,对于text字段如 果需要使用聚合,需要开启fielddata,但是通常建议,因为fielddata是将聚合使用的数据结构由磁盘...这个 keyword 子字段在索引时并不会被分词器拆分成单独的词条,而是作为一个完整的字符串被存储。这样,你就可以对这个字段进行精确值匹配、排序或者聚合操作。...管道聚合 在 Elasticsearch 中,管道聚合(pipeline aggregations)是指这样一种聚合:它以其他聚合的结果作为输入,并进行进一步处理。..."size": 10 的意思是只返回销售量最高的前10个产品(即只返回前10个)。 "order": { "_count": "desc" } 表示按中文档的数量(也就是销售量)降序排序。

    46820

    【ES三周年】elasticsearch 核心概念

    数据节点(Data Node):负责存储数据和处理数据相关的搜索、索引等操作。数据节点是集群中最常见的节点类型。它们执行 CRUD 操作、聚合以及其他数据操作。...它可以使用各种聚合器,例如平均值、最小值、最大值、总计数等。elasticsearch 其他类型的 DSL:过滤器 DSL:过滤器 DSL 可以用于过滤文档,从而返回符合特定条件的文档。...以下是一些常见的 elasticsearch DSL 聚合语句示例:Terms Aggregation:术语聚合用于统计文档集合中各个术语的出现次数,并根据计数结果对它们进行分组。...Bucket Aggregations:用于将数据分成各种,并对每个内的数据执行聚合操作,例如按日期范围分、按字段值分等。...Pipeline Aggregations:用于对其他聚合结果进行操作,例如计算移动平均值、比较不同内数据的百分比等。

    3.1K80

    elasticsearch 聚合 : 指标聚合聚合、管道聚合解析使用总结

    二、聚合查询类型 Metric Aggregations(指标聚合) 概述:指标聚合返回基于字段值的度量结果,如总和、平均值、最小值、最大值等。这些度量结果可以直接用于分析数据中的特定指标。...Bucket Aggregations(聚合) 概述:聚合类似于SQL中的GROUP BY操作,它将文档分组到不同的中,并对每个中的文档进行聚合计算。...Pipeline Aggregations(管道聚合) 概述:管道聚合其他聚合的结果作为输入,并对其进行进一步的处理或计算。这种聚合类型允许用户对聚合结果进行复杂的转换和分析。...通过查询语句过滤出符合条件的文档集合,然后对这些文档进行聚合分析,可以得到更加准确和有用的结果。 嵌套聚合:Elasticsearch支持嵌套聚合,即在一个聚合内部可以包含其他聚合。...分词字段 分词字段(如text类型)通常用于存储需要分词和全文搜索的文本数据。

    56310

    go-ElasticSearch入门看这一篇就够了(一)

    就好比我在公司看其他同事的代码,我不是上来就看代码,而是先把项目运行起来,看一看实现了什么功能,哪个功能在代码中怎么实现的,有目的性的学习,才能更好的得到吸收。好啦,废话啦,开始接下来的学习。...知道了什么是聚合,下面我们就来看其中几个重要关键字: 的就是一组数据的集合,对数据分组后,得到一组组的数据,就是一个个的。ES中聚合,指的就是先对数据进行分组。...指标:指标指的是对文档进行统计计算方式,又叫指标聚合聚合,说的就是先对数据进行分组(分),然后对每一个内的数据进行指标聚合。... - 聚合类型,代表我们想要怎么统计数据,主要有两大类聚合类型,聚合和指标聚合,这两类聚合又包括多种聚合类型,例如:指标聚合:sum、avg, 聚合:terms、...GET /order/_search { "size" : 0, // 设置size=0的意思就是,仅返回聚合查询结果,返回普通query查询结果。

    2.3K30

    Elasticsearch常见的5个错误及解决策略

    群友讨论实际问题 聚合爆炸是计算问题,可能导致某些聚合生成呈指数增长,并可能导致不受控制的内存使用。...Elasticsearch“terms”字段根据您的数据构建存储,但无法预测将提前创建多少存储。 对于由多个子聚合组成的父聚合,这可能会有问题。...aggs" : { 9"other_aggs" : { 10"terms" : { 11"field" : "players", 12"size" : 5 13} 14} 15} 16} 17} 18} 聚合返回前...10名球员的列表以及每位顶级球员的前五名支持球员的列表 - 这样总共将返回50个值。...terms聚合可以显示为使用每个级别的的树。因此,以上聚合中每个顶级球员的将构成第一级,而另一个聚合中的每个支持球员的将构成第二级。因此,一个团队将生产n²

    1.2K21

    Spring认证中国教育管理中心-Spring Data MongoDB教程七

    有关更多信息,请参阅MongoDB 的聚合框架和其他数据聚合工具的完整参考文档。...流经聚合管道的文档被分类到中。多面分类可以对同一组输入文档进行各种聚合,而无需多次检索输入文档。 存储操作根据指定的表达式和存储边界将传入文档分类为多个组,称为存储。...每个存储在输出中表示为一个文档。 BucketOperation使用一组定义的边界将传入的文档分组到这些类别中。边界需要排序。以下清单显示了存储操作的一些示例: 示例 101....以下清单显示了存储操作的示例: 示例 102....请注意,可以在 MongoDB 聚合框架参考文档的$bucket一节和 $bucketAuto一节中找到有关存储表达式的更多详细信息。

    8.1K30
    领券